Filing 6 NOTICE of Appearance by David A. Loglisci on behalf of Forchelli Deegan Terrana LLP (aty to be noticed) (Loglisci, David) |
ORDER re #5 Letter filed by Northcoast Maintenance Corp.: Plaintiffs' motion (filed before this matter was removed) seeking a default against the defendant the Internal Revenue Service is terminated as withdrawn. Ordered by Judge Denis R. Hurley on 2/1/2022. (Gapinski, Michele) |
Filing 5 Letter withdrawal of motion by Northcoast Maintenance Corp. (Brown, Michael) |
Electronic ORDER granting DE #4 Motion for Extension of Time to Answer. On consent, the deadline for the United States to answer or otherwise respond to the Complaint is extended to and including 3/29/2022. Ordered by Magistrate Judge Steven I. Locke on 1/28/2022. (Pincsak, Lydia) |
Filing 4 MOTION for Extension of Time to File Answer by Internal Revenue Service. (York, Benton) |
Filing 3 In accordance with Rule 73 of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ure and Local Rule 73.1, the parties are notified that if all parties consent a United States magistrate judge of this court is available to conduct all proceedings in this civil action including a (jury or nonjury) trial and to order the entry of a final judgment. Attached to the Notice is a blank copy of the consent form that should be filled out, signed and filed electronically only if all parties wish to consent. The form may also be accessed at the following link: #http://www.uscourts.gov/uscourts/FormsAndFees/Forms/AO085.pdf. You may withhold your consent without adverse substantive consequences. Do NOT return or file the consent unless all parties have signed the consent. (Jakubowski, Laura) |
Filing 2 This attorney case opening filing has been checked for quality control. See the attachment for corrections that were made. (Jakubowski, Laura) |
Case Assigned to Judge Denis R. Hurley and Magistrate Judge Steven I. Locke. Please download and review the Individual Practices of the assigned Judges, located on our #website. Attorneys are responsible for providing courtesy copies to judges where their Individual Practices require such. (Jakubowski, Laura) |
Filing 1 NOTICE OF REMOVAL by Internal Revenue Service from Supreme Court of NY, Nassau County, case number 602647/2014. Was the Disclosure Statement on Civil Cover Sheet completed -No (Attachments: #1 Exhibit A -- State Court Docket Entries, #2 Civil Cover Sheet) (York, Benton) Modified on 1/24/2022 (Jakubowski, Laura). |
